Missouri Library Network Corporation in Ballwin

Missouri Library Network Corporation

13610 Barrett Office Dr Ste 206
63021
(314) 394-1320
Write your review of Missouri Library Network Corporation
Select your star rating
Please select your star rating
Your review must be longer than 15 characters